Here's my take on the RV park.
We recently spent a week in Reno at the Grand Sierra RV park. It is an ok park, definitely nothing fancy. It is a large park, but the spaces are all dirt and sand, no grass and no trees, so it is pretty dusty and warm. There are hook-ups for water, electric and sewer, but no tv cable.
We asked to be close to the fenced dog park area. There were 2 fenced areas adjacent to each other, again these were all dirt and sand, no grass. No doggy bags provided in the dog area, but we always bring our own, so no problem there. However, we often found big poop piles left in the area, possibly by the permanent park residents dogs, so we cleaned up after more than our own pups. The fence also needed some repairs, nothing major, but was really ugly. I checked for safety, and there was no place my pups could escape
Our 4 dogs ran around and played and got real dusty there, but had a great time.
I did complain to the park management that they needed to make some improvements to the RV park and the dog area, and would be nice if they were made before summer 2013. They responded that they did have plans for some upgrades, but cable TV isn't one of the upgrades.
I would rank the park as a 5-6 out of 10. Would we stay again, yes. They are not taking reservations for summer till Jan 2013.
